Fans of the enormously popular Transformers action-adventure entertainment franchise will revel in the upcoming television event on The Hub cable network - a five-part original mini-series, Monday-Friday, November 29 - December 3, showcasing Transformers: Prime, a new CGI-animated television series coming to the network. The Hub, a TV network for kids and their families, is a joint venture of Discovery Communications and Hasbro, Inc., and is available to 60 million U.S. cable and satellite households.

Transformers: Prime is produced for The Hub by Hasbro Studios. Alex Kurtzman, Roberto Orci and Jeff Kline are executive producers. Kurtzman, Orci served as executive producers of the feature films Transformers, Transformers: Revenge of the Fallen and Star Trek. Kline was also executive producer of the animated series Jackie Chan Adventures.

Prior to the five-day mini-series event, The Hub will spotlight Transformers: Prime with a Thanksgiving holiday weekend sneak preview of the mini-series and an action-packed lineup of Transformers: Prime-related programming that begins Friday, November 26. Kicking off the Transformers schedule is a special episode of the original series "Hubworld," a weekly, half-hour, pop culture magazine that will be dedicated to the Transformers phenomenon, Friday, November 26 (3 p.m. ET).

"Hubworld"'s special Transformers: Prime episode will be followed by a half-hour behind-the-special, "Hub Exclusive: Transformers: Prime" (3:30 p.m. ET), which culminates with the premiere of the first two half-hour episodes (at 4 p.m. and 4:30 p.m. ET) of the Transformers: Prime mini-series, in which arch rivals the Autobots and Decepticons once again face-off in their epic rivalry for control of Earth. The all-new mini-series will feature iconic characters of the franchise, including Autobots Optimus Prime and Bumblebee, and the ominous Decepticon Megatron, as well as introducing new human characters to the action series.

Following the Transformers: Prime Friday lineup of programming, The Hub will showcase the highly anticipated new series with the five-day mini-series event, Monday-Friday, November 29-December 3 (6:30 p.m. - 7 p.m. ET). The week-long run will include three additional new episodes of Transformers: Prime on Wednesday, Thursday and Friday, December 1-3.
